Bioscopia: Where Science Conquers Evil
Windows - 2001
Description of Bioscopia: Where Science Conquers Evil
Bioscopia brings together elements of a great simulation game with a fascinating storyline. With the added challenges of learning and using science, players experience a game that provides more than merely a chance to reach a high score. Trapped in Bioscopia, an abandoned biological research station, the young researcher enters a door and awakens the laboratory's long-dormant robots that quickly begin pumping poisonous gas throughout the lab. Time is running out. You must find and save her! But, it won't be easy. You will need to use principles of human biology, cell biology, genetics, botany, and zoology to solve the puzzles that unlock the doors leading to the trapped researcher.Deductive ability and skill are required to meet the challenge. You must free the girl from her hiding place, while learning many exciting facts from the world of biology. Learn as you play, and biology becomes the adventure.

Couldn't mount BIN/CUE files. Converted both CD1 & 2 as ISO files but CD1 would not mount. Extracted CD1 ISO file as content (essentially extracted all the folders and files). Mounted CD2 ISO file. Tried installing under Win 10 but seemed to hang when checking system resources. So used VIRTUAL BOX with WINXP installation and ran SETUP.EXE from the extracted CD1 content. You need to make sure you have mapped the location of CD1 extracted files and the mounted CD2 to your WINXP environment. I have played a bit and so far it works fine.
